WebJun 15, 2024 · Symptoms of a Hypoglycemic Episode. Low blood sugar symptoms can start and progress quickly. Symptoms typically start mildly and may not be recognized right away. Symptoms include: Feeling shaky. Being nervous or anxious. Sweating or experiencing chills and clamminess. Feeling irritable or impatient. Feeling confused. WebIf you don’t have diabetes and have symptoms of hypoglycemia, your provider may: Measure blood glucose levels while you are having the symptoms Watch that the symptoms are eased when you eat foods that have a lot of sugar You may also have lab tests to measure how much insulin your body makes.
